Our take

A sprig of lavender crushed between thumb and forefinger, a mug of chamomile tea left to cool on a windowsill—this is the impression Chá de Camomila e Lavanda by Natura aims for, and for its first thirty minutes, it nails that quiet, herbal comfort. The opening is a clean, almost cooling burst of aromatic lavender, not soapy or medicinal, but soft and slightly green, quickly joined by chamomile’s apple-like sweetness. Together they form a gentle floral-herbal haze that feels like warm laundry dried in a field of wildflowers. There’s a faint peppery brightness from the fresh spicy accord, but it never overwhelms the central duo.

Then the reality of the numbers sets in. By the two-hour mark, this fragrance has pulled a vanishing act that would make a stage magician jealous. The sillage is a whisper even from the first spray, and longevity clocks in at a miserly two-point-six-one. What remains on skin is a flat, powdery floral ghost with none of the chamomile’s cozy depth. This is a fragrance that exists solely in the air around a freshly-made bed, not on a person moving through the world.

It suits the person who values subtle, skin-level scent over projection—someone who wants to smell like a cup of herbal tea at an afternoon spa, not a night out. Skip it if you crave presence or any kind of statement. Wear it on a quiet spring morning, in a loose linen shirt, when the only companion you need is the breeze. But don’t expect it to last through lunch.
